Output 054245d43001833753c15399ee66a17d702d19074ed723a2b82b18e18ea40de8:1

value
863347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18fc24c76faff743f12b1514a8674fbacbcab27 OP_EQUAL
address
3Hssk3fSsDdTfxWQvEBciX9aYAoeEUGn36
transaction
054245d43001833753c15399ee66a17d702d19074ed723a2b82b18e18ea40de8
confirmations
342534
spent
true